Don't ignore what this game is made of people

Port of a PS2 game.

2 years later

Full price (same cost as the PS2 version at release)

No additional content at all

No graphical upgrade at all (even the framerate is the same)

No advertising budget was given to the game. Zero commercials shot or anything. (Confirmed by capcom themselves)

Multiple delays on the game already

The original was a niche title that bombed as well

The Wii library has matured to the point that bottom feeding for games isn't necessary anymore like it was last year when RE:Wii came out. People will be playing Tales of Symph 2 and Rockband MK:Wii, Wiifit and Wiiware games when this comes out. You know, REAL efforts worth the time rather than SLUMMING on old ports of games that bombed already and are being released with even LESS advertising than it had the first time it underperformed.

This game is a fruit freaking cocktail of ingredients needed to make a game bomb, and no amount of wishful thinking, not desire to see it do well just so the Wii can have another good 3rd party seller is going to save this game. It is doomed, a sum of its own crappy make up. It has nothing going for it. Nothing.
